AdvoLogix Help

Billing Preview ⚡Component

Updated on

The Billing Preview is useful for obtaining an immediate perspective on time and expenses relative to each account, matter and across the entire organization. Though the component has been designed to work in conjunction with accounting integrations, organizations will find the functionality quite useful for reviewing time and expense metrics at the account and matter levels.

The information in this article applies to the billing preview functionality available in lightning experience. Please see this article for information regarding the classic user experience.

From AdvoLogix Matter Management v1.140.x onward, the new Billing Preview⚡component is generated using the billings object. For more details, follow this link.

What is the billing preview?

The Billing Preview provides the following functionality:

  • Subtotals at the time, expense, matter and account level.
  • A summary view by accounts or by matters by using the collapsible headings to hide details.
  • Multiple filters including start/end date, account, matter, timekeeper, type, disposition, status, focus matters, list filters and other filters.
  • The hyperlink single-click access to time, expense, timekeeper, matter and account records.
  • The printable view to generate multiple output formats such as LEDES file per billing party of matter or Excel spreadsheet or a CSV data file.

It is important to note the AdvoLogix Billing Preview is based on the fundamental principal that, for billing and accounting purposes, all billable matters must be assigned to a primary account.

Can I control what is displayed in the billing preview?

There are several ways to identify the information selected for display in the Billing Preview.

  1. The date range is used to select records based on their respective date values. The Start Date will default to the first day of the previous month and the End Date will default to the current date.

  2. [optional] Entering an Account value will limit the preview to matters that are assigned to the selected account.

  3. [optional] Entering a Matter value will limit the preview to billings that are assigned to the selected matter.

  4. [optional] Entering a Timekeeper value will limit the preview to billings that are assigned to the selected timekeeper.

  5. Select the type of billings to be shown within the preview window.

  6. Select one or more billing Disposition values (Bill, Do Not Bill, Hold or No Charge). The default values are required by the Accounting Seed integration. Otherwise, you may use your own values here. It is advised to name the disposition options the same throughout your organization.

  7. The view menu option provides the end user with the ability to limit the matters appearing in the Billing Preview.
    • Select Focus Matters to limit the display to matters qualified for the user's focus matters list.
    • The Use List Filter, when enabled, allows the user to select a matter list view filter. This allows users the ability to display only those items related to matters which meet the criteria of the list view's filter.

  8. Select one or more billing Status values (Unprocessed, Billed, Not Billed). The default values are required by the Accounting Seed integration. Otherwise, you may use your own values here. It is advised to name the status options the same throughout your organization.

  9. [optional] Exclude any previously exported billings from the preview window.

  10. Upon adjusting any of these criteria, the Apply button becomes visible to refresh the preview with the current filter criteria. Use the Clear all filters action link on this button bar to reset the filters to the default view parameters.

  11. Use the Create Billing action button to manually add a billing. Your users can add an ad-hoc billing entry for an Administrative Fee or Other Fee using this action button.
    (If your administrators have configured any custom actions for the billing preview, then this button will show an additional drop menu to activate those actions. For more details, follow this link.)

  12. Sections can be easily collapsed (or expanded) in one of two ways:
    • The entire preview can be controlled by using the Collapse All or Expand All icon (shown above).
    • Individual sections may be controlled by clicking the icon in each account or matter heading.

  13. Use this menu to generate and export the current preview window out in one of following ways:
    • Send the report to a Printable View. For more details on supported export formats, follow this link.
    • Post the report to a user's Chatter Feed.

  14. Refresh the current preview with data.

  15. Select multiple billings (with their checkbox) then use the Mass Edit button to edit multiple rows at the same time.

  16. The chart icon displays a selection of charts in the sidebar.

  17. The chatter icon displays the chatter feed for the selected billing record.

  18. The filter icon shows or hides the filter panes for the preview window.

What values are displayed in the billing preview?

The Billing Preview is essentially a dynamic columnar report interface with section headings at the account, matter and billing type levels.

  1. The account heading is the top level and provides the heading for all matters assigned to the account.

  2. The total column for the account row includes the tally for all matters assigned to the account.

  3. There may be multiple matter headings for each account.  All billing records will be grouped by type at the matter level.

  4. The total column for the matter row includes the tally for all billing records assigned to the matter.

  5. Each matter displays a subsection for billing records by type assigned to the matter. Since billing hours are universal across all records, the quantity header displays total hours in the quantity heading.

  6. The total amount of all quantity for each billing type is displayed in the quantity heading.

  7. The total amount of all billings by type is displayed in the billing type group heading.

  8. When a record is marked as Do Not Bill, the Total column will be adjusted to $-0-.

Did you know?

  • The billing preview does not enforce a maximum number of billings to be shown at a time per matter, but it is advisable to make use of the filters to limit the data displayed within the preview window, as large amount of data will make the window appear frozen at times during normal operations.
  • The Next and Previous buttons will be made available to browse through the list of billing records when there are more than 200 records to show at a time in the billing preview.
  • The billing preview may be optionally configured to display custom fields.

Can I open or edit records from the billing preview?

  1. View the account record.
  2. View the matter record.
  3. View the billing record.
  4. View the source record (which could be a Time, Expense or Matter Fee Arrangement).
  5. View the timekeeper record.
  6. The action menu allows full edit and delete capability for the billing record.

Can I customize the columns being displayed in the billing preview?

The highlighted list of columns are displayed by default in the billing preview. To customize the display and add/remove any columns from the preview window, your administrators can edit the field set provided by AdvoLogix to show or hide any columns within this window.

Follow these steps to control which columns to display within the preview window:

  • Go to Salesforce Setup | Object Manager | Billing.
  • Select Field Sets from the sidebar.
  • Edit the field set named fieldSet_BillingPreview.
  • Add or remove fields from the In the Field Set section to show or hide them from the billing preview window. (Only the fields within the In the Field Set section are displayed within preview window.)

Billing Preview allows customizing display of columns between the Date and Quantity columns only. The other columns, such as, Date, Quantity, Amount and Total cannot be removed from the preview window.

Can the billing preview be invoked with preset filter options?

Yes!  The billing preview can be launched with a variety of preset filter options. This may be especially useful for calling the preview directly from a matter or an account with the resulting display filtered to the context of the underlying matter or account.

Billing Preview Filter Parameters

Billing Preview URL Format 

https://<INSTANCE-URL>/lightning/n/advpm__Billing_Preview_Lightning?<URL-PARAMETERS>

Where

  • <INSTANCE-URL>  is your organizations instance within the Salesforce platform.
  • <URL-PARAMETERS> are the optional filter parameters defined below.

Example

https://advex.ap1.visual.force.com/lightning/n/advpm__Billing_Preview_Lightning?advpm__accountId=<Account Id>&advpm__matterId=<Matter ID>

Supported URL Parameters:

  • advpm__accountId
    The Account ID filter parameter.
  • advpm__matterId
    Matter ID filter parameter.
  • advpm__timekeeperId
    Timekeeper ID filter parameter.
  • advpm__fromDate
    From Date, to be provided in the format of YYYY-MM-DD.
  • advpm__toDate
    To Date, to be provided in the format of YYYY-MM-DD.
  • advpm__filterByDisposition
    Comma separated list of Disposition filter values.
  • advpm__filterByStatus
    Comma separated list of Status filter values.
  • advpm__filterByType
    Comma separated list of Billing Type filter values.
  • advpm__hideExported
    True or False value.

All URL parameters must be appended with the AdvoLogix Matter Management namespace and two underscores (i.e. advpm__).

Previous Article Introduction to Billings
Next Article Manage Billing Parties⚡ Component
Still need help? Click here!
AdvoLogix® is a registered trademark of AdvoLogix.com LLC a Texas Limited Liability Company. All references to other trademarks belonging to third parties that appear on this website, documentation, or other materials shall be understood to refer to those registered trademarks owned by others, and not to any trademark belonging to AdvoLogix. Otherwise, all material herein is the copyright of AdvoLogix.com LLC. All Rights Reserved.